Yasmin Khakoo is a scholar working on Genetics, Neurology and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Yasmin Khakoo has authored 71 papers receiving a total of 1.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 38 papers in Genetics, 32 papers in Neurology and 18 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. Recurrent topics in Yasmin Khakoo’s work include Glioma Diagnosis and Treatment (38 papers), Neuroblastoma Research and Treatments (21 papers) and Brain Metastases and Treatment (15 papers). Yasmin Khakoo is often cited by papers focused on Glioma Diagnosis and Treatment (38 papers), Neuroblastoma Research and Treatments (21 papers) and Brain Metastases and Treatment (15 papers). Yasmin Khakoo coll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Argentina. Yasmin Khakoo's co-authors include Ira J. Dunkel, Suzanne L. Wolden, Mark M. Souweidane, Stephen W. Gilheeney, Robert C. Seeger, Katherine K. Matthay, Daniel O. Stram, Andreas F. Hottinger, Nuno Lobo Antunes and Sofia Haque and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, PLoS ONE and Neurology.
